Vietnam seafood export performance ā Q3 2025: Seafood exports maintained positive momentum in Q3, rising +8.6% year-on-year (YoY) in value terms. Growth was recorded across most major markets, except the U.S. and Australia.
By product category:
š Pangasius increased slightly +3.3% QoQ
š¦ Whiteleg shrimp surged +22% QoQ
š¦ Squid and octopus rose +18.2% QoQ
š¦ Black tiger shrimp declined -11.2% QoQ and -6.4% YoY after strong Q2 growth š Tuna continued to fall -10.7% YoY
Outlook for Q4 2025
Looking ahead to Q4 2025, Vietnamās seafood exports are expected to decline by 5ā7% compared with Q3, equivalent to a modest year-on-year increase of +1.5% to +3%.
ā ļøThe slowdown will likely stem from:
Domestic supply disruptions due to storms and adverse weather;
Softening demand from major import markets;
Continued downward pressure on pangasius export prices;
Shrimp prices are potentially adjusting downward amid heightened competition from India.
